FREE SHIPPING WHEN YOU SPEND OVER $99

Search results for: 'touch that 21606 00 over'

Showing 145-168 of 4908 items

Did you mean
touch that 261.6 00 over
touch test 21606 00 over
Related search terms
touch tape 250ml 00 optiv
touch test 200g 00 onion
touch tabs 2.5ml 00 over
touch tan 2.1g 00 optim
touch tape 200ml 00 oil
Page
per page